Description

No more published.


First issue of the first English edition, with 'Directions for the book-binder for placing the cuts' in later, corrected state. A French edition was published simultaneously, but no more of the author's travels were issued before the Amsterdam edition of 1711.


The plates, mostly folding, include additional, engraved title.


"Solyman III" is normally described in reference works as Soleyman I.


Pages 265-330 are omitted in the pagination of the first sequence. "The coronation of Solyman III. the present king of Persia." has separate titlepage and pagination. With a frontispiece portrait of Sir John Chardin, maps of the journey, plates of buildings in Persia and separate indexes to both parts.


Indexed in: Wing(2) C2043.
